That being said, I wanted to share that I recently got the ArdSCSino Plus working on my PC-9821 Ap2/U8W.

To do so, I needed to use a special, generic SCSI CD-ROM driver, which you can download here:
https://drive.google.com/drive/folders/1WVFHWGHf85AQ4byh6KqYBroDH-GCBsnA

Notes on this driver's usage can be found here:
https://blog.tlfoxhuman.net/2023/08/09/use-scsi-cd-drive-on-pc98/

It functions more-or-less the same as other CD-ROM drivers, but takes an /I argument to specify SCSI ID.

For example...

DEVICEHIGH=A:\CDDRV.SYS /D:CD_101 /I1
Anyway, I just figured I'd share! This device isn't incredibly easy to get a hold of, but if you manage to snag one, it works beautifully. I even routed the 3.5mm audio output from the ArdSCSino Plus into the "LINE IN" on the rear of the Ap2 for seamless passthrough.

Small update, unfortunately I cannot get the device coupled with that generic SCSI driver to work with Policenauts. There is strange audio and graphic glitching that I don't see when using an original file-slot CD-ROM drive.

Figured I'd share for those who may encounter this in the future.
